17

小程序开发教程:打造卓越APP!

发布时间:2023-05-23 阅读量:0 来源: 易企优

随着移动互联网的快速发展,小程序成为了一个备受关注的领域。小程序作为一种全新的应用形态,具有轻量级、便捷、易传播等特点,已经成为了很多企业和个人进行业务拓展和品牌推广的首选。那么,如何开发一个优秀的小程序呢?本文将从小程序的定义、开发流程、技术栈以及实例应用等多个方面进行详细探讨。

一、什么是小程序

小程序是一种不需要下载安装即可使用的应用,它实现了应用和服务的无缝衔接,用户可以直接在聊天界面、社交媒体或其他场景中使用。与传统应用相比,小程序具有使用门槛低、启动速度快、占用空间少等特点。

二、小程序开发流程

在进行小程序开发之前,我们需要先了解一下小程序开发流程。一般来说,小程序开发可以分为以下几个步骤:

1.需求分析:确定小程序的功能需求和交互设计;

2.界面设计:根据需求分析结果进行小程序界面的设计;

3.开发环境搭建:安装小程序开发工具,并创建小程序项目;

4.代码编写:根据需求分析和界面设计进行代码编写;

5.测试调试:对小程序进行测试和调试,确保其稳定性和可用性;

6.提交审核:将开发完成的小程序提交至微信公众平台审核。

三、小程序技术栈

在进行小程序开发时,我们需要使用到的技术栈主要包括:

1.微信开发者工具:用于小程序的开发、调试和发布等工作;

2. WXML( ):一种类似 HTML 的标记语言,用于描述小程序的结构;

小程序开发教程:打造卓越APP!

3. WXSS( Style Sheet):一种类似 CSS 的样式语言,用于描述小程序的样式;

4. :用于实现小程序的交互效果和业务逻辑;

5.小程序 API:提供了一系列操作小程序的接口,如获取用户信息、调用支付等。

四、实例应用

下面我们以一个购物类小程序为例,来介绍如何进行小程序开发。该小程序主要功能包括商品展示、购物车管理、订单管理等。

1.需求分析

根据产品需求文档,我们确定该购物类小程序需要实现以下功能:

1.商品列表展示:展示所有商品的名称、价格、图片等信息;

2.商品详情页:展示商品的详细信息,包括尺寸、颜色、库存等信息;

3.购物车管理:用户可以将商品加入购物车,并可以对购物车中的商品进行增删改查等操作;

4.订单管理:用户可以查看已下单的订单,并可以对订单进行取消、支付等操作。

2.界面设计

根据需求分析结果,我们设计了以下几个界面:

1.商品列表页:展示所有商品的名称、价格、图片等信息;

小程序开发教程:打造卓越APP!

2.商品详情页:展示商品的详细信息,包括尺寸、颜色、库存等信息;

3.购物车页:展示用户加入购物车的所有商品,并可以进行增删改查等操作;

4.订单列表页:展示用户已下单的订单,并可以进行取消、支付等操作。

3.代码编写

在进行代码编写时,我们需要根据需求分析和界面设计,使用 WXML 和 WXSS 进行页面布局和样式设置,使用 实现小程序的交互效果和业务逻辑。

以下是一个简单的商品列表页面代码:


  
    
    
      {{item.name}}
      {{item.price}}
    
  

/* WXSS */
. {
  : flex;
  flex-wrap: wrap;
  -: space-;
}
.item {
  width: 45%;
  -: 20rpx;
}
.img {
  width: 100%;
}
.name {
  font-size: 28rpx;
}
.price {
  font-size: 26rpx;
}

4.测试调试

在进行测试调试时,我们需要使用微信开发者工具对小程序进行模拟器测试和真机测试,确保其稳定性和可用性。

5.提交审核

在完成开发和测试后,我们需要将小程序提交至微信公众平台审核。审核通过后,我们就可以正式发布小程序了。

五、总结

本文从小程序的定义、开发流程、技术栈以及实例应用等多个方面进行了详细探讨。小程序作为一种全新的应用形态,具有轻量级、便捷、易传播等特点,已经成为了很多企业和个人进行业务拓展和品牌推广的首选。希望本文能够对大家进行参考和借鉴,让大家能够更好地开发出优秀的小程序。

最后,推荐一个专业的互联网服务平台——易企优(),它提供了一系列的互联网服务,如小程序开发、网站建设、营销推广等,为企业和个人提供了全方位的互联网解决方案。

TAG标签:小程序开发教程 
声明:本文"小程序开发教程:打造卓越APP!":http://www.tpsem.com/wzjianshe/show510.html内容和图片部分来自互联网。若本站收录的信息无意侵犯了贵司版权,请给我们来信,我们会及时处理和回复。